Solution for r2-5r+2=0 equation:



r2-5r+2=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
r^2-5r+2=0
a = 1; b = -5; c = +2;
Δ = b2-4ac
Δ = -52-4·1·2
Δ = 17
The delta value is higher than zero, so the equation has two solutions
We use following formulas to calculate our solutions:
$r_{1}=\frac{-b-\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}$
$r_{2}=\frac{-b+\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}$

$r_{1}=\frac{-b-\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}=\frac{-(-5)-\sqrt{17}}{2*1}=\frac{5-\sqrt{17}}{2} $
$r_{2}=\frac{-b+\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}=\frac{-(-5)+\sqrt{17}}{2*1}=\frac{5+\sqrt{17}}{2} $
